In Seattle, WA and beyond, research facilities primarily dissect drug metabolites through advanced techniques such as chromatography and mass spectrometry. These dual methods enable both the separation and detailed analysis of compounds. The initial step typically involves gas chromatography-mass spectrometry (GC-MS) or liquid chromatography-mass spectrometry (LC-MS) to segment metabolite mixtures. This is followed by mass spectrometry that measures ions' mass-to-charge ratios, confirming each metabolite's identity and quantity. Additional methodologies like radioactive labeling and nuclear magnetic resonance (NMR) spectroscopy are also employed.

Step-by-step analysis

Sample Preparation: A biological specimen urine or blood, for instance is gathered and might undergo preliminary treatment. Determining urine creatinine levels in Seattle, WA, for instance, can normalize metabolite concentrations.

Chromatographic Separation: The sample is infused into a chromatographic mechanism, ensuring compound segregation based on chemical attributes.

  • Liquid Chromatography (LC): Here, samples transition through a liquid suspension within a column, achieving segregation through differential travel speeds.
  • Gas Chromatography (GC): Samples are vaporized and passed through a column, particularly effective for volatile substances.

Mass Spectrometry (MS): Segregated compounds advance to a mass spectrometry phase.

  • Ionization: Compounds assume a charged state, either positive or negative.
  • Mass-to-Charge Ratio: A mass spectrometer then discerns each ion's mass-to-charge signature, unique to each metabolite.
  • Tandem Mass Spectrometry (MS/MS): In most modern Seattle, WA labs, a secondary mass spectrometry phase ensures heightened sensitivity and specificity.

Identification and Quantification: Analysts interpret mass spectrometer outcomes for metabolite recognition and measurement, correlating signal strength to metabolite concentration.

Confirmation: Utilizing precise techniques like LC-MS/MS and GC-MS, confirmatory tests eradicate initial screening false positives.

Alternative and Complementary Methods:

  • Radioactive Labeling: Drugs tagged with radioactive isotopes yield detectable signals during metabolite transition across LC systems.
  • Nuclear Magnetic Resonance (NMR) Spectroscopy: NMR elucidates metabolite structure, invaluable in discerning isomers and identifying chemical alterations per NIH findings.

Different Types of Drug Tests in Seattle, WA

In Seattle, WA, various drug testing methodologies utilize distinct biological samples to ascertain drug consumption over defined durations. Widely practiced, urine analysis leads the realm, but hair, saliva, blood, breath, and sweat testing also feature prominently for specific applications, such as recent versus long-term detection. The optimal method hinges on testing objectives and the necessary detection timeframe.

  • Urine Tests: Predominant in the industry for detecting recent usage.
  • Hair Tests: Used to investigate historical patterns, ideal for Seattle, WA's pre-employment contexts.
  • Saliva Tests: Effective for tracing immediate usage, suitable for post-incident investigations.
  • Blood Tests: Applied in medical emergencies and pinpointing current intoxicants.
  • Breath Tests: Frequently conducted in law enforcement and safety checkpoints within Seattle, WA.
  • Sweat Tests: Utilized for ongoing monitoring situations, especially in rehabilitation or judicial scenarios.

Urine Drug Test in Seattle, WA

Urine Drug Test Expertise in Seattle, WA: A vastly common and economic drug-testing methodology.

Detection Window: Variable by substance, typically spanning a few days to a week; however, chronic marijuana users could show positive for 30 days or longer.

Best Suited For: Random drug tests, pre-employment assessments, or when there's a reasonable suspicion. This method excels in detecting recent drug ingestion.

Drawbacks: This method could be more susceptible to tampering than other specimen collection processes.

Hair Drug Test in Seattle, WA

Hair analysis in Seattle, WA extends the most considerable detection horizon concerning drug consumption.

Detection Window: Reaches upwards of 90 days for a majority of substances. Body hair's slower growth could potentially extend this timeframe.

Best for: Assessing extensive historical drug usage patterns and suitable for pre-employment assessments in security-sensitive sectors.

Drawbacks: Heightened costs and protracted result times, coupled with an inability to detect very recent drug activity due to delayed emergence in hair growth post-consumption.

Saliva Drug Test in Seattle, WA

Known as oral fluid testing, this involves collection using a swab from the mouth.

Duration of Detection: Brief, commonly around 24-48 hours for most drugs, though longer for some.

Optimal Use: In Seattle, WA, ideal for revealing immediate drug use, such as in post-accident evaluations or when there is reasonable suspicion. Its non-invasive nature makes tampering difficult.

Limitations: Narrow detection period and occasionally diminished accuracy relative to urine or blood assessments.

Blood Drug Test in Seattle, WA

In Seattle, WA, the controlled procedure of extracting a sample via venipuncture provides direct drug level insights, marking this test efficient yet invasive.

Detection window: Significantly brief, ranging from mere minutes to a few hours; as substances circulate and disperse rapidly.

Best for: Critical in urgent healthcare scenarios, like overdose cases, or when establishing immediate intoxication levels.

Drawbacks: Its invasiveness and higher expense, coupled with a constrained detection period, render it unsuitable for broad-spectrum screening.

Breath Alcohol Test in Seattle, WA

In Seattle, WA, the breath test, predominantly utilized by law enforcement officers, assesses alcohol levels in a person's breath.

The detection duration is quite restricted, capturing recent alcohol consumption within 12 to 24 hours.

This method is exceptionally useful for determining current intoxication levels or impairment at road checkpoints.

However, its exclusive focus on alcohol and the very short detection timeframe are considered significant drawbacks.

Sweat Patch Test in Seattle, WA

Sweat Monitoring in Seattle, WA – Continuous Drug Detection

Utilizing a patch affixed to the skin, this method in Seattle, WA permits sweat collection across days to support continuous drug consumption detection.

Detection Timeframe: Offers cumulative drug use insights over multiple days to weeks.

Preferred Usage: Primarily selected for sustained monitoring purposes, such as within parole or rehabilitation frameworks in Seattle, WA.

Limitations: Prone to environmental contamination, and less frequently adopted than alternative options within the state.

How Does Your Body Process THC?

In Seattle, WA, THC is absorbed extensively into diverse body tissues and organs, such as the brain, heart, and fatty tissue, or is transformed in the liver into metabolites like 11-hydroxy-THC and carboxy-THC. Approximately 65% of cannabis is expelled via feces, while 20% is eliminated through urine, with the remainder stored in the body.

THC's gradual release from body tissues back into the bloodstream, before eventual liver metabolism, is notable. Among habitual users, THC accumulates faster in fat tissues than it's expelled, facilitating positive drug test results long after usage.

How Long is Marijuana in Your System?

THC's lipophilic nature gives it a protracted half-life, influencing detection timeframes based on individual usage patterns in Seattle, WA.

Studies reveal that for occasional users, the half-life stands at 1.3 days, while habitual consumption extends the half-life to a span of 5 to 13 days.

The detection of THC is further contingent upon the biological specimen assessed, with varied windows of detection highlighting Seattle, WA's nuanced testing landscape.
